Broken or damaged panes

Double-glazed windows are made from two sheets of glass, with an air gap between them and filled with inert gases like argon or krypton. This allows heat to flow through the window, while slowing it down so that it doesn't warm your house too much.

However, this part of the assembly could be damaged and even broken and cause condensation between the panes of the window or draft that is able to enter the window. If it's not replaced promptly it will not only impact how well your home is insulated but also increase your energy bills.

Experts can carry out most double glazing repairs. You must first be able determine the root of the issue. You should inspect your windows at least every year to check for damage. This can include cracks in the glass or loose seal. You should also detect condensation between the panes or feel a draft inside your home. If this is the case, it's best to seek professional help instead of trying to fix the issue yourself.

One important thing to remember is that a cracked window pane could break into large pieces. This is caused by the tensile stress that occurs when glass is stretched out too the limit. To prevent this from happening, it is recommended to replace a window pane as soon as it becomes damaged, rather than putting it off for.

The first step to repair damaged or broken window pane is to clean the frame and get rid of any glass shards. To protect your hands it is essential to wear gloves. Take off any putty or caulking from the frame's edges. Once the frame is prepped you can then put in new putty and place the new window pane.

Seals

The window seals are the crucial component of a double- or triple-pane window, which prevents heat from moving between the panes. If a window seal is defective, it could allow air and condensation to pass through the windows and become unattractive but also compromises the insulating properties of the windows in your home. It is important to fix a broken seal as soon as possible.

Many people believe that they can repair a double-glazed window seal on their own, but this isn't always an ideal idea. Double-glazed windows are a complex system that requires a skilled and skilled tradesperson to fix. It is possible to make the issue worse if you attempt to fix it yourself. It is best to leave this type task to professionals. You can use our free service to find the best tradesperson for the job.

Failing window seals are usually loudly announced, causing condensation to build up that cannot be removed between the glass panes. It is also typical for windows with a damaged seal to give a blurred or wavy appearance that distorts the view from inside or outside of your house. Failed seals not only look bad, but also decrease the insulation properties of your window. This makes your house more expensive and difficult to heat and cool.

In certain cases you might be able to repair a window seal without having to replace the whole frame. If your window is covered by warranty, or if you have a warranty with the company who installed it, they'll usually be able to repair the seal for free.

It is important to check the seals on your windows regularly, especially if they are older than 15 years. They'll get worse with time and can lead to issues such as drafts, fogging and high energy bills. Some window seals can be left in place. However, it's recommended to repair them when you spot the issue.

Frames

If your frames are damaged or have become loose, it might be possible to repair them rather than replace the whole window. A local double glazing repair company can typically provide quick and effective repairs. They can also offer advice on how to keep your windows and doors in good working order. You will have a wide selection of styles and colors to choose from.

In a survey of double-glazing homeowners there were some who complained of issues with the frames and mechanisms. These included windows becoming difficult to open and close, and doors falling or sagging over time. These problems can sometimes be resolved by lubricating handles or hinges, or re-screwing loose fixings. If the issue persists, it's best to get an expert examine the issue.

Another common complaint was the frames allowing draughts to enter the room or allowing cold, damp air to penetrate. There are several things that can be done to prevent this from happening, such as installing trickle vents in the frame or adding insulation in the walls around the windows. Some people have tried putting up blinds or curtains to block out the cold however this can cause other issues such as condensation and mould.

Double glass that is misted is usually caused by moisture buildup between the glass panes. It could be due to dirty seals or condensation or the combination of both. If you have misted double glazing, it's important to identify the cause of the issue and fix it as quickly as you can. If moisture isn't dealt with it could leak into the cavity causing wood decay.

The most effective way to clean a window frame is to apply a damp cloth. If the frames have deep grooves or are stubborn to clean, you can use cleaning fluid. Always test the cleaning fluid on a small portion of the frame to ensure that it doesn't harm or stain it.

In some cases, you may be able to fix the crack in your window yourself with a tape made of heavy-duty. This will prevent superficial cracks, such as stress cracks caused by low temperatures, from escalating. You should apply a strong-hold tape such as masking tape, and extend it outwards over the crack on both sides to hold it in place.

double glazed units near me-glazed window crack repair may also be achieved by applying epoxy to the damaged area. This is more labor intensive, however it can make your damaged window appear new once it is repaired. Before you do this, you should clean the area around and over the crack of glass with water and soap. Then, you should follow the instructions on the epoxy and apply it to the crack, making sure that it's evenly applied across both surfaces.
